A well-run Debris Removal Service does far more than just toss whatever into the back of a truck. Experienced teams examine what can be recycled, contributed, or repurposed before anything heads to land fill, which matters a good deal to ecologically mindful families across NSW. Old furnishings in reasonable condition might be handed down to charity, scrap metal gets separated for recycling, and green waste from garden clean-ups is frequently composted or mulched instead of dumped. This sorting process reflects a more comprehensive shift in how waste is dealt with nowadays, with councils and personal operators alike promoting less material to end up buried in the ground. Choosing a Debris Removal Service that prioritises these practices offers customers peace of mind that their undesirable possessions aren't just being disposed of without a doubt. It likewise means Sydney's currently stretched landfill sites deal with a little less pressure with every task completed responsibly.
Prices structures for a Debris Removal Service can vary a fair bit depending upon just how much rubbish needs clearing and what type of access the home offers. A ground-floor balcony with a driveway is naturally simpler and more affordable to service than a fifth-floor home without any lift, since teams require additional time and workforce to carry items down by hand. Many reputable companies provide free, no-obligation quotes based upon images or an on-site evaluation, which helps avoid nasty surprises once the task is underway. It's always worth asking whether the quote consists of disposal charges, labour, and transportation, since some smaller sized operators tack on service charges after the fact. Comparing a couple of quotes from different business operating around Sydney is a practical technique, particularly for bigger tasks like full property clean-outs or commercial fit-out waste, where costs can accumulate rapidly if not managed thoroughly from the outset.
Timing plays a substantial role in how efficiently a Debris Removal Service can be organized, particularly throughout hectic durations such as the lead-up to Christmas or right after extreme weather condition occasions when demand for clean-up services spikes considerably. Booking ahead of time, even by just a couple of days, typically protects a better time slot and can in some cases result in a more competitive rate compared to last-minute demands. For immediate situations, such as an occupant needing a property cleared before a new lease begins, lots of Sydney-based business now provide same-day or next-day consultations to accommodate tight deadlines. It assists to interact clearly about the type and volume of rubbish beforehand so the team shows up with the appropriate lorry and adequate hands to finish the job in one see. Poor interaction at the booking stage is among the most typical factors jobs run over time or need an expensive 2nd trip.
